Which of the following relations is a function?

A

{(1, 4), (2, 6), (1, 5), (3, 9)}

B

{(3,3), (2, 1), (1,2), (2, 3)}

C

{(1, 2), (2,2),(3,2), (4,2)}

D

{(3, 1), (3,2), (3,3), (3, 4)}

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C
